Understanding Remote IT Help Desk Services

Remote IT help desk services provide companies with immediate technical assistance for their IT-related queries and issues via telephone, email, or live chat. This support model not only enables swift troubleshooting but also facilitates proactive maintenance, which is essential in today’s fast-paced digital world.

  • Accessibility: Services are typically available 24/7, addressing issues in real-time.
  • Cost-Effectiveness: Reduces the need for on-site staff, leading to lower operational costs.
  • Scalability: Easily adjustable to meet the varying needs of growing enterprises.

Key Features of Remote IT Help Desk Services

The effectiveness of a remote IT help desk hinges on several critical features. Here are the essential capabilities you should look for when selecting a remote support partner:

  • Multi-Channel Support: Access to support through various channels like chat, email, and phone ensures that assistance is always at hand, regardless of the preferred mode of communication.
  • Comprehensive Troubleshooting: Ability to diagnose and resolve a wide range of IT issues from software glitches to network failures.
  • Remote Access Technologies: Utilization of tools that allow technicians to securely connect with and troubleshoot business systems from afar.
  • Proactive Monitoring: Continuous surveillance of systems to identify potential issues before they escalate into serious problems.

Best Practices for Choosing a Remote IT Help Desk

Choosing the right remote IT help desk provider is crucial for realizing the benefits outlined above. Here are some best practices to consider during the selection process:

  • Evaluate Experience: Look for providers with a strong track record and positive reviews from businesses within your industry.
  • Check for Certifications: Ensure that the provider’s team possesses the necessary certifications and expertise to handle your IT needs.
  • Assess Response Times: Understand the provider's average response times to assess how quickly they can address issues.
  • Inquire About Service Level Agreements (SLAs): SLAs should clearly define the level of service you can expect, including uptime guarantees and support response times.
  • Look for Customization: Identify whether the service can be tailored to meet your specific business requirements and challenges.
